我已將使用者配置為批量接受來自主題的消息。如何將其轉發到新主題?我希望每個使用的消息都像它自己的消息一樣轉發。因此,消耗的 X 個消息量將產生 X 個消息量。這是我目前的設置:@KafkaListener(topics = "input")@SendTo("output")public ConsumerRecords consume(ConsumerRecords records) { // Do things return records;}下面是引發的異常:網站:找不到適用于 Java.util.Array 列表類的方法
1 回答

慕容森
TA貢獻1853條經驗 獲得超18個贊
不支持該功能。在任何情況下,都不能將 發送到 .ConsumerRecordProducer
不過,這有效
@KafkaListener(id = "foo", topics = "input")
@SendTo("output")
public List<String> consume(List<String> data) {
return data;
}
(其中 是反序列化程序創建的類型)。String
添加回答
舉報
0/150
提交
取消